Physical properties

Typically dark gray-green to black, fine-grained, massive, and dull to slightly vitreous; Mohs hardness about 5–6, no visible cleavage, and specific gravity roughly 2.8–3.1. The rounded shape and smooth surface indicate natural water wear or tumbling.

Formation & geological history

Forms when mafic magma cools, either rapidly as volcanic basalt or more slowly in shallow intrusions as diabase/dolerite; commonly Mesozoic to Recent, depending on locality. The green tint may reflect chlorite or other alteration minerals.

Uses & applications

Used as crushed aggregate, road stone, riprap, and landscaping material; attractive polished pieces are sold as inexpensive specimens or cabochons.

Geological facts

Its fine texture and dark color indicate iron- and magnesium-rich magma. Magnetite may make it weakly magnetic, while vesicles would suggest basalt rather than dense diabase.

Field identification & locations

Identify by its uniform dark fine grain, substantial weight, lack of layering, and possible magnetism; common in volcanic regions, oceanic crust, and glacial or river gravels. Exact identification requires a fresh surface or thin section.
